Страница 1 из 1

А как подключиться к БД FB или IB из Delphi for PHP?

Добавлено: 20 сен 2008, 13:10
Antoxa
Получил Trial версию Delphi for PHP 2.0 для ознакомления.

Никак на удается подключиться в БД FB, сообщает:

Warning: ibase_pconnect() [function.ibase-pconnect]: unavailable database in C:\Program Files\CodeGear\Delphi for PHP\2.0\vcl\interbase.inc.php on line 287

Application raised an exception class EDatabaseError with message 'Cannot connect to database server'

Re: А как подключиться к БД FB или IB из Delphi for PHP?

Добавлено: 20 сен 2008, 15:57
Attid
unavailable database
укажи правильную БД

Re: А как подключиться к БД FB или IB из Delphi for PHP?

Добавлено: 20 сен 2008, 16:09
Antoxa
Подскажите, кто использовал скрипт, написанный с помоью Delphi for PHP на сайте и какой у вас хостинг?

У меня скрипт работает на ПК, на котором установлен Delphi For PHP, а на хостинге infobox не работает, сообщает ошибку если в скрипте есть унаследование класса.

Т.е. простая "форома" в Delphi for PHP:

<?php
require_once("../vcl/vcl.inc.php");
//Includes
use_unit("classes.inc.php");
use_unit("forms.inc.php");
use_unit("extctrls.inc.php");
use_unit("stdctrls.inc.php");

//Class definition
class Unit2 extends Page
{
public $Edit1 = null;
}

global $application;

global $Unit2;

//Creates the form
$Unit2=new Unit2($application);

//Read from resource file
$Unit2->loadResource(__FILE__);

//Shows the form
$Unit2->show();

?>

На хостинге уже не работает, сообщает:

Parse error: parse error, unexpected T_STRING, expecting T_OLD_FUNCTION or T_FUNCTION or T_VAR or '}' in строка "public $Edit1 = null;"

Подскажите, у кого реально работает хоть, что-нибудь написанное на Delphi For PHP на коммерческом хостинге

Re: А как подключиться к БД FB или IB из Delphi for PHP?

Добавлено: 20 сен 2008, 20:34
kdv
unavailable database
www.ibase.ru/ibfaq.htm#unavail

Re: А как подключиться к БД FB или IB из Delphi for PHP?

Добавлено: 22 сен 2008, 13:17
Attid
Antoxa писал(а):Подскажите, кто использовал скрипт, написанный с помоью Delphi for PHP на сайте и какой у вас хостинг?
сомневаюсь что таких найдешь.
проверь версию php.